Description for Gite

The cottage boasts an exceptional location on a charming pedestrian street called rue Nationale in Rennes. Its proximity to the Republique and Saint Anne metro stations, both just a 2-minute walk away, ensures convenient transportation options. Additionally, the train station, universities, and Pontchaillou hospital are all within a 5-minute radius. Guests will have the opportunity to indulge in an array of activities, including visits to cinemas, theaters, the St Georges swimming pool, museums, and the renowned market at Lices. The historic center of Rennes, with its picturesque timbered houses, is also easily accessible.

Attractions

  • Rennes Cathedral: Located just a short walk from Rue Nationale, Rennes Cathedral, also known as Cathédrale Saint-Pierre de Rennes, is a magnificent example of Gothic architecture. It features stunning stained glass windows and intricate stone carvings.
  • Parc du Thabor: A beautiful public park situated in the heart of Rennes, Parc du Thabor offers a serene escape from the bustling city. It features lush gardens, a botanical display, fountains, and even a small zoo.
  • Musée des Beaux-Arts de Rennes: This fine arts museum is housed in a former university building and displays an extensive collection of artworks ranging from the Middle Ages to the present day. It includes works by renowned artists such as Rubens, Picasso, and Monet.
  • Les Champs Libres: A cultural complex that combines a library, a science center, and an art gallery, Les Champs Libres offers a diverse range of exhibits and activities. Visitors can explore interactive science exhibits, browse through a vast collection of books, or admire contemporary art.
  • Parliament of Brittany: The Parliament of Brittany, or Parlement de Bretagne, is a historic building that serves as the courthouse for the region. Its stunning Baroque architecture and grand interior make it an impressive sight to behold.
  • Place des Lices: A vibrant square located in the historic center of Rennes, Place des Lices is famous for its lively Saturday morning market. It's the perfect place to immerse yourself in the local culture, taste regional specialties, and browse through a variety of products.
  • Les Tombées de la Nuit: If you're interested in performing arts, don't miss Les Tombées de la Nuit. It is a renowned festival held annually in Rennes, featuring an eclectic mix of theater, music, dance, and street performances. It offers a unique opportunity to experience innovative and avant-garde artistic expressions.
  • Musée de Bretagne: Situated in the historical building of Les Champs Libres, Musée de Bretagne showcases the rich history and heritage of the Brittany region. The museum exhibits a vast collection of artifacts, photographs, and interactive displays that provide insights into the local culture and traditions.
  • Place de la Mairie: Located in the heart of the city, Place de la Mairie is the central square of Rennes. It is surrounded by beautiful historic buildings, cafes, and shops, making it a perfect spot to relax, people-watch, and soak up the lively atmosphere. 10. Les Halles Martenot: A bustling covered market, Les Halles Martenot is a food lover's paradise. Here, you can find a wide range of fresh local produce, seafood, cheese, pastries, and other gastronomic delights. It's a great place to explore and indulge in the flavors of Brittany.
